Why You Need Them and How to Get Them

Client testimonials are more than just positive feedback; they are powerful tools that can significantly enhance your business's credibility and attract new customers. In today's digital age, where potential clients often research extensively before making a purchase, testimonials serve as authentic social proof of your company's value and reliability. Here’s why you should prioritize collecting testimonials and how to do it effectively.

Why Client Testimonials Matter

Build Trust and Credibility
Testimonials from satisfied clients provide third-party validation, which is crucial for building trust with potential customers. When prospects see that others have had positive experiences, they are more likely to trust your brand.

Highlight Your Strengths
Clients often mention specific aspects they appreciated in your service or product, such as customer support, quality, or innovation. These insights help highlight your unique selling points.

Improve Search Engine Optimisation (SEO)
User-generated content, including testimonials, can improve your website’s SEO. Positive reviews and feedback often contain keywords relevant to your business, helping you rank higher in search engine results.

Increase Conversion Rates
Authentic testimonials can be the deciding factor for potential customers who are on the fence. They provide the reassurance needed to convert leads into clients.

Foster Customer Relationships
Asking for and showcasing testimonials show that you value your clients’ opinions. This can enhance client loyalty and encourage repeat business.

How to Collect Effective Testimonials

Ask at the Right Time
Timing is crucial. Request testimonials when your client is most satisfied, such as immediately after a successful project completion or a positive customer service interaction. 

Make It Easy
Simplify the process by providing a template or a few questions to guide them. The easier it is for clients to provide feedback, the more likely they are to do it.

Use Various Formats
While written testimonials are valuable, consider also requesting video testimonials. Videos add a personal touch and can be more engaging.

Ask Specific Questions

  • Encourage detailed responses by asking specific questions like:
  • What challenges did you face before using our product/service?
  • How has our product/service benefited you?
  • What made you choose us over competitors?
  • Would you recommend our service to others?

Showcase Testimonials Prominently
Place testimonials on high-traffic pages of your website, such as the homepage, product pages, and landing pages. Also, share them on social media and in marketing materials.

Follow Up
If a client agrees to give a testimonial but doesn’t follow through, send a polite reminder. Persistence is key, but ensure your requests are respectful and not too frequent.

Offer Incentives
While the best testimonials are genuine and unsolicited, offering a small incentive like a discount on future services can encourage clients to provide feedback.

Displaying Testimonials Effectively

On Your Website
Create a dedicated testimonials page and integrate snippets throughout your site.

Social Media
Share testimonials in posts or stories to reach a broader audience.

Email Marketing
Include testimonials in your email campaigns to build trust with your subscribers.

Presentations and Proposals
Incorporate testimonials into your sales pitches to add credibility.

Client testimonials are invaluable assets that can propel your business forward. By actively seeking and strategically displaying positive feedback, you enhance your brand's reputation and attract new clients. Start prioritising testimonials today and watch your business grow.
